About the Role

Description

     

This position is responsible for:

  •  Assembly, including soldering, of the company’s medical and wellness devices for use by patients, HCPs, company representatives, and related customers. 
  • Programming of devices with the company’s proprietary device operating software. 
  • Preparation of packaging materials for devices and related materials. 
  • Perform packaging and labeling operations for movement into Finished Goods. 
  • Completion of required quality control / quality assurance as the relate to the company’s products. 

  

Job Responsibilities:

  • Prepare the company’s product for assembly and programming operations (e.g., power-on / charging test)
  • Program the company’s devices in accordance with established work instructions, travel tickets, and related specifications
  • Perform ultrasonic welding of product in accordance with established work instructions, travel tickets, and related specifications
  • Prepare packaging materials, including the assembly of finished product boxes, gathering / provision of required literature (e.g. Instructions for Use, Warnings / ISI Cards, Getting Started cards) for inclusion in the finished package.
  • Performing any required in-process inspection operations and documenting the results on appropriate production and/or inspection records
  • Ensuring required production and quality systems documentation has been completed in accordance with established procedures. 


Requirements

  • Experience in a manufacturing / production environment or technical field is preferred
  • Aptitude for math and written / language skills.
  • Self-starter capable of managing multiple projects at one time
  • Good working computer skills; knowledge of MS Excel and Word helpful.
